Ro Water Treatment in Monmouth County, NJ
RO water treatment services involve installing and maintaining systems designed to purify well water or other private water sources. These systems typically use reverse osmosis technology to remove contaminants such as bacteria, viruses, sediments, and dissolved solids, providing homeowners with cleaner, better-tasting water. Projects often include installing new RO units, upgrading existing systems, or troubleshooting issues related to water quality. Property owners usually want to understand the specific contaminants present in their water, the maintenance requirements of the system, and how the treatment process can improve overall water safety and taste.
Before requesting RO water treatment services, homeowners should consider the current quality of their water supply and any specific concerns such as odors, discoloration, or mineral content. It’s helpful to know if the property relies on well water or municipal supply, as this impacts the type of system needed. Understanding the ongoing maintenance needs and system lifespan can also assist in making an informed decision. Ro Water Treatment Questions
What is RO water treatment? RO water treatment uses a semi-permeable membrane to remove impurities and contaminants from tap water, providing cleaner drinking water for homes and properties.
Why consider RO water treatment for a property? It helps improve water quality by reducing dissolved solids, sediments, and harmful substances, making water safer and better tasting.
What types of projects typically need RO water treatment? Residential homes, commercial buildings, and properties with well water or concerns about water purity often benefit from RO systems.
What should property owners know about installing RO systems? Proper system sizing and maintenance are important for effective operation and ensuring water quality over time.
